Output 7389014a38faaa48f7996cf45573cb3e7b1a7b4262267ae4df523c8cdc928361:1

value
1708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f39bd7856fce5425f1a18a254ffbe69c264f58 OP_EQUAL
address
37FJJHay6QHfTXCMnJf5iQUzoZC95DqS7b
transaction
7389014a38faaa48f7996cf45573cb3e7b1a7b4262267ae4df523c8cdc928361
spent
true